#4fa9de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fa9de is composed of 31% red, 66.3%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 202.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 59%. #4fa9de color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#0053bd.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#4fa9de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fa9de has RGB values of R:79, G:169,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5220830.

Shades and Tints of #4fa9de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f4f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fa9de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f989e is the less saturated color, while #2fb1fe is the most saturated one.
